Description
The main house was built in 1768 with classic Georgian proportions and styling. It retains original features including panelling, carved fireplaces, and original oak floorboards. It has been sensitively and extensively renovated with all new services, bathrooms, and kitchen by Tom Howley. It also has an interesting history that is deeply woven into village life and London society. There is a separate 4 bedroom studio within the grounds which is totally self-contained.
A generous driveway sweeps up through wrought iron gates to the parking area and Studio with garages. York stone steps lead to the main house, opening into a spacious entrance hall with period flooring. This then leads into the family sitting room, a fine panelled Georgian dining room, study with oak mezzanine and impressive vaulted kitchen. The kitchen faces south and east with folding doors to a further stone terrace. Additional ground floor amenities include a walk-in larder, utility room, music room, and boot room with cloakroom. The first floor has a main bedroom suite with en suite bathroom and vaulted dressing room and a library ladder leading to a further mezzanine. There are two further double bedrooms and a family bathroom. The second floor provides two additional large bedrooms featuring exposed roof timbers and brickwork, each with an en suite bathroom. The property also benefits from a cellar accessed from the outside, with full height ceilings.
A totally enclosed garden surrounds the property with most rooms in the main house and the studio looking south over terraced lawns. A kitchen garden with raised beds faces east to west and also contains a traditional potting shed.
The studio also offers three covered car ports (one leading to a further internal garage/gym). The ground floor has a large entrance hall, bedroom shower room and utility. The first floor contains an open-plan kitchen with dining area and sitting room with large studio windows, log burner, three further bedrooms and family bathroom. This is a substantial property that combines period character with modern amenities, offering flexible living spaces and extensive grounds.
In the midst of rolling countryside, the Winterslow villages sit in a rural setting on the Hampshire/Wiltshire border close to Salisbury, Stockbridge, Winchester and Romsey. Locally there are churches, a pub, sports field, general store and post office, primary school, tennis courts, village hall with coffee shop and a doctors' surgery. Independent schools in the area include Salisbury Cathedral, Farleigh, Chaffyn Grove, Leehurst Swan and Godolphin. A regular train service from Grateley (9 miles) provides a direct route to London taking from 74 minutes. There are also services from Salisbury (7 miles) and Winchester (19 miles).
